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/3] MFD: TWL4030: print warning for out-of-order
	script loading

Hi Amit,

On Wed, Jul 08, 2009 at 01:49:35PM +0300, Amit Kucheria wrote:
> When the sleep script is loaded before the wakeup script, there is a
> chance that the system might go to sleep before the wakeup script
> loading is completed. This will lead to a system that does not wakeup
> and has been observed to cause non-booting boards.
> 
> Various options were considered to solve this problem, including
> modification of the core twl4030 power code to be smart enough to
> reorder the loading of the scripts. But it felt too over-engineered.
> 
> Hence this patch just warns the DPS script developer so that they may be
> reordered in the board-code itself.

>  drivers/mfd/twl4030-power.c |   11 +++++++++--
>  1 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/mfd/twl4030-power.c b/drivers/mfd/twl4030-power.c
> index bb9e45f..ef4cc4e 100644
> --- a/drivers/mfd/twl4030-power.c
> +++ b/drivers/mfd/twl4030-power.c
> @@ -315,6 +315,7 @@ static int __init load_triton_script(struct twl4030_script *tscript)
>  {
>  	u8 address = triton_next_free_address;
>  	int err;
> +	static u8 mask = 0;
>  
>  	/* Make sure the script isn't going beyond last valid address */
>  	if ((address + tscript->size) > (END_OF_SCRIPT-1)) {
> @@ -331,14 +332,20 @@ static int __init load_triton_script(struct twl4030_script *tscript)
>  	if (tscript->flags & TRITON_WRST_SCRIPT)
>  		err |= config_warmreset_sequence(address);
>  
> -	if (tscript->flags & TRITON_WAKEUP12_SCRIPT)
> +	if (tscript->flags & TRITON_WAKEUP12_SCRIPT) {
>  		err |= config_wakeup12_sequence(address);
> +		mask |= TRITON_WAKEUP12_SCRIPT;
> +	}
>  
>  	if (tscript->flags & TRITON_WAKEUP3_SCRIPT)
>  		err |= config_wakeup3_sequence(address);
>  
> -	if (tscript->flags & TRITON_SLEEP_SCRIPT)
> +	if (tscript->flags & TRITON_SLEEP_SCRIPT) {
Wouldnt something like:

     if (tscript->flags & (TRITON_SLEEP_SCRIPT | TRITON_WAKEUP12_SCRIPT)) {

save us from using an additional mask variable and simplify this patch ?

Cheers,
Samuel.


> +		if (!(mask & TRITON_WAKEUP12_SCRIPT))
> +			printk(KERN_WARNING
> +			       "TWL4030: Wakeup script not yet loaded. Might lead to boot failure on some boards\n");
>  		err |= config_sleep_sequence(address);
> +	}
>  
>  	return err;
>  }
